The growing use of artificial intelligence in national security, government operations, and enterprise environments is creating a new cybersecurity challenge: how should organizations evaluate AI systems when security, safety, ethics, procurement, and governance requirements intersect?
A recent federal court ruling involving Anthropic and the U.S. Department of Defense has brought this question into sharp focus.
A federal judge ruled in favor of Anthropic in its legal challenge against the Pentagon’s decision to designate the AI company as a national security supply chain risk. The court found that the government’s actions were unlawful and lacked a sufficient legal basis. The government is expected to challenge the ruling.
The dispute developed after Anthropic raised restrictions around certain military applications of its AI technology, including concerns involving mass surveillance and autonomous weapons. The disagreement eventually escalated into a broader conflict involving government procurement, national security, AI safety, and the responsibilities of technology providers.

AI Is Becoming Part of the Technology Supply Chain
Traditional supply chain security typically focuses on hardware, software components, cloud providers, contractors, and third party service providers.
AI introduces another layer.
An organization’s AI supply chain may include:
• Foundation model providers
• AI application vendors
• Cloud infrastructure providers
• Model hosting platforms
• Data providers
• AI development tools
• APIs and integrations
• Open source AI components
• AI agents
• Security and monitoring platforms
A weakness or governance failure involving any of these components could potentially affect the broader organization.
This means AI vendor risk should be treated as part of enterprise third party risk management rather than as a separate technology issue.

The Importance of Evidence Based Supply Chain Risk Assessments
The Anthropic case also highlights an important cybersecurity principle: supply chain risk decisions should be supported by clear, measurable, and technically defensible evidence.
Organizations assessing an AI provider should consider:
• Security architecture
• Data handling practices
• Privacy controls
• Software development practices
• Vulnerability management
• Incident history
• Model security
• Access controls
• Compliance certifications
• Third party dependencies
• Business continuity
• Incident response capabilities
A structured assessment can help organizations distinguish actual security exposure from assumptions or incomplete information.

Enterprise Organizations Should Learn From This
The situation provides several lessons for businesses adopting AI.
1. Establish an AI Vendor Risk Program
AI providers should undergo security and compliance assessments before being approved for sensitive workloads.
2. Define Acceptable AI Use
Organizations should document where AI can be used, what information it can access, and which activities require human approval.
3. Protect Sensitive Data
AI systems should not receive unrestricted access to confidential business information. Strong data classification and access controls are essential.
4. Maintain Human Oversight
High impact AI decisions should have appropriate human review and escalation mechanisms.
5. Monitor AI Activity
Organizations should maintain visibility into model usage, API activity, data access, agent behavior, and unusual activity.
6. Plan for Vendor Disruption
Organizations should have contingency plans if an AI provider becomes unavailable, restricted, compromised, or unsuitable for a particular business requirement.
7. Continuously Reassess AI Risk
AI technology changes rapidly. Vendor assessments should therefore be continuous rather than performed only during initial procurement.
